World Champion Boston Red Sox Manager Alex Cora will be on campus Tuesday, April 23 to speak on the importance of strong leadership and service. Alex Cora led the Boston Red Sox to become World Series Champions in 2018, his first year as manager. Prior to becoming the youngest Red Sox manager in history to win a World Series, Cora had a 16-year playing career with 14 seasons in the majors and was a baseball analyst for ESPN. The event will be held in the Fine Arts Center and is free and open to the public.
